Learning to Drive in Grange-over-Sands

Grange-over-Sands sits on the edge of Morecambe Bay and feels like a coastal village with Victorian charm. Learners get quiet streets on the Promenade and short trips onto busier roads such as the A590. You will find tidal views and a small-town pace that helps when you start driving. Local traffic patterns change with tourist season and tides, so drive with a bit of local awareness.

Nearest Test Centre: Kendal (Oxenholme Road)

Kendal (Oxenholme Road) is the nearest practical test centre, about 10.8 miles away from Grange-over-Sands by road. Expect a drive of roughly 20-30 minutes depending on traffic on the A590 and through Kendal town centre. Kendal had a 65.5% pass rate and runs about 29 tests a year, so slots can be limited, especially at short notice, Data source: DVSA 2024-2025. The test route will include A-roads and urban junctions rather than coastal Promenade driving.

Pass Rate Analysis

Kendal's pass rate of 65.5% is noticeably higher than the national average of 47.3%, Data source: DVSA 2024-2025. Male candidates at Kendal passed at 66.7% and female candidates at 64.3%, Data source: DVSA 2024-2025. Heysham, another nearby centre, shows a 50.4% pass rate, Data source: DVSA 2024-2025, while Lancaster's pass rate was not provided in the supplied data. Higher pass rates at Kendal may reflect local test routes and the small number of tests conducted there each year.

Local Driving Tips

Start on the Promenade to build confidence with low-speed steering and observation. Practice joining and leaving the A590, and use the junctions near Kents Bank station to work on multi-lane merges and slip roads. Watch for low winter sun over Morecambe Bay on west-facing stretches, it can cause glare at key junctions. Cartmel and surrounding lanes are narrow and may require careful steering and mirror use. Spend time on roundabouts nearer Kendal to get used to higher traffic speeds and lane discipline.

Choosing an Instructor in Grange-over-Sands

There is only one listed driving instructor in Grange-over-Sands, so availability may be limited and you may need to book early. Consider instructors from Kendal or Lancaster if you want more choice or different teaching styles. Expect to pay a premium for instructors who travel to pick you up from the Promenade or Kents Bank area. Ask about pass rates, test practice routes, and whether they will take you to the Kendal test centre for mock tests.

Lesson Costs in Grange-over-Sands

Local lesson prices are not listed in the supplied data, and costs vary with instructor travel, pick-up service, and booking frequency. Rural areas with few instructors often see higher hourly rates to cover travel time and lower economies of scale.
